Liver resection, also known as hepatectomy, is a surgery to remove a portion or all of the liver due to tumors, cysts, or other conditions. In India, the cost of liver resection (hepatectomy) surgery for international patients ranges from USD 8,000 to USD 10,000. For Indian patients, it costs between INR 3.5 and 5.5 lakh. The cost may vary based on factors such as the hospital, surgeon’s fee, and complexity of the procedure.
